Original Description
Step into the dazzling world of Mistinguett by Charles, where Carl Gesmar's brushstrokes capture the electric energy of Jazz Age Paris. This iconic poster design (1919) immortalizes France's highest-paid entertainer mid-performance, her feathers trembling with movement against bold Art Deco geometries. Gesmar, the "poster prince" of Montmartre, distilled the cabaret spirit through flattened perspectives and vibrant hand-stenciled tones (pochoir), revolutionizing advertising into fine art. Today, this masterpiece epitomizes the golden era of Parisian nightlife, with originals displayed at Musée des Arts Décoratifs – its dynamic synthesis of commercial appeal and avant-garde aesthetics influenced later movements like Pop Art. The elongated figure and arabesque typography remain benchmark studies in graphic design history.
